I got a phone message from a PD , I know a prematch will be offered to me . The fact is I have 6 more interviews to attend and I am sooo confused .
I did not want to decline the offer at this moment , but if she does not give me some time to think about it I will need to . Can i ask her for some time to think about it?
If I need to , How can I decline the offer in a very polite way ?

You said "got a phone message", does that mean you did not actually speak to the PD on the phone? Also, when is your last interview?



If your last interview is in the next 3 weeks and you have not talked to the PD, wait about 10 days, call the office at night and leave a message that you are out of town on interviews, give an expected return date in another 10 days time (that's the 3 weeks) and tell him/her that you will call at that time.



If it's longer than 3 weeks, decide if you want the offer and save yourself time, money and inconvenience of going to multiple interviews.


Most important consideration, is it a place where you want to spend the next 3 years of your life?
